Work wear for a very short person

4 replies

DogTheHellhound · 15/01/2017 20:26

Hi, I struggle to find nice smart work clothes as I am only 4'11" and I am thin but I am quite well muscled so not dainty. I have very s short legs so very very hard to find decent trousers. I usually wear nice dresses, black tights and smart blazer. I'm a teacher and in a new job and the board's are really high up so I have to really reach, risking flashing the students 😱

I was wondering if you could help give me ideas?

NewPantsforaNewYear · 17/01/2017 13:59

It sounds as if you dress reasonably smartly for work. Have you tried a neat pair of trousers?
These ones from Banana Republic are 28" in petite.
You could wear them with a fine knit or a shirt/top.

AlfaMummy · 17/01/2017 19:15

I wear petite trousers and find that the shortest of the petite ranges is Dorothy Perkins - sometimes too short!! Defo worth a look.
